5. Poor Surface Finish Increases Pressure Drop and Erosion
A 125–250 Ra surface finish is critical for laminar flow stability. Flanges with rougher finishes (>500 Ra) create turbulent eddies, increasing pressure loss by up to 18% and accelerating erosion in high-velocity applications like steam lines or LNG transfer systems.

What is an orifice flange, and how does it differ from a standard flange?
An orifice flange is a specialized flange with precisely machined bore openings and tapped holes to mount an orifice plate for differential pressure flow measurement. Unlike standard ASME B16.5 flanges, orifice flanges include pressure-tap holes (typically 1/4" NPT), ring gaskets, and are manufactured to ANSI B16.36 with tighter tolerances for flow accuracy.
